Output 29ec62b0249458a716dcd648fb1a6c13954bfdc5cd0c1d1eb5d0ee50ca5e929d:1

value
510895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98be790d0873d36b0e451823e08312ccd17592cb OP_EQUALVERIFY OP_CHECKSIG
address
1EvdtSmKhkx5W8y3RYRCHs2nL8dN1CNiWy
transaction
29ec62b0249458a716dcd648fb1a6c13954bfdc5cd0c1d1eb5d0ee50ca5e929d
spent
true